Recognizing Water Intrusion Challenges in Caldwell-Area Properties

Living in the Treasure Valley means dealing with a mix of soil types, from sandy loam near the river to heavier clays further out. These soils react differently to moisture – some drain quickly, others hold water like a sponge right against your foundation. Combine that with our distinct seasonal rainfall patterns – relatively dry summers followed by wetter fall, winter, and spring months (sometimes with rapid snowmelt runoff!) – and fluctuating groundwater levels, and you’ve got a recipe for potential water intrusion if your home isn’t prepared. It’s not just about the big storms; consistent moisture build-up is often the real culprit.

So, where does water typically sneak in? Crawlspaces are notorious offenders, often letting moisture seep up from the ground or through porous foundation walls. Basements, being below ground level, face pressure from surrounding saturated soil (that’s hydrostatic pressure) and can leak through wall cracks, floor joints, or window wells. Even slab foundations aren’t immune; water can wick up through concrete or find entry points around utility penetrations. Knowing these common vulnerabilities is the first step in defence.

Poor site grading is a huge factor I see all too often. If the ground around your house slopes *towards* the foundation instead of away, you’re basically inviting surface runoff to pool against your walls. Add hydrostatic pressure from saturated soil pushing inward, and even solid concrete can eventually give way. Surface runoff from heavy rain or melting snow needs a clear path away from your home, otherwise, it will find the path of least resistance – often right into your basement or crawlspace.

Your house usually gives you warning signs long before a major flood. That musty smell in the basement? Often mold or mildew feeding on excess moisture. See white, powdery stuff (efflorescence) on concrete walls? That’s mineral deposits left behind as water evaporates. Dark stains, peeling paint, damp spots, or even an increase in pests like spiders or centipedes seeking damp environments are all clues. Don’t ignore these little signals; they’re telling you something’s amiss.

Ignoring water issues is, frankly, asking for trouble. Untreated moisture leads to mold growth, which can impact indoor air quality and health. Structural wood can rot, concrete can degrade, and foundations can even shift or crack under prolonged pressure. The repair costs? They can escalate quickly, ranging from mold remediation and replacing damaged drywall and flooring to complex (and expensive) foundation stabilization. A damp crawlspace now could mean thousands in repairs later.

Key Waterproofing Boise Homes Require for Long-Term Protection

Alright, let’s talk solutions. When we say “waterproofing,” it generally falls into two camps: interior and exterior methods. Interior solutions manage water *after* it enters the foundation envelope, using things like channel drains along the floor edge, weeping tiles, special wall coatings, and sump pumps to collect and eject water. Exterior methods aim to stop water *before* it even reaches the foundation wall, involving excavation, applying waterproof membranes or coatings directly to the outside of the foundation, and installing robust drainage systems like French drains. Often, the best approach combines elements of both.

How do these systems actually *stop* water? Moisture barriers, like heavy-duty plastic sheeting in crawlspaces, physically block water vapor from rising out of the soil. Liquid-applied membranes or specialized cementitious coatings create a seamless waterproof layer on foundation walls (inside or out). Flexible sealants are used to close cracks and gaps around pipes or joints where water might find a path. It’s about creating a continuous barrier at those vulnerable points identified earlier.

Ah, the humble sump pump. In areas with high water tables or where interior drainage systems collect significant water, a sump pump is essential. It sits in a basin (sump pit) at the lowest point of your basement or crawlspace. When water fills the basin to a certain level, a float switch activates the pump, which then discharges the water safely away from your foundation via a pipe. Without it, collected water would just build up, defeating the purpose of the drainage system.

Exterior drainage is often the first line of defence. Perimeter French drains – basically gravel-filled trenches with a perforated pipe at the bottom – are fantastic for intercepting groundwater before it reaches your foundation. They collect water and use gravity (or sometimes connect to a sump pump) to move it away. Channel drains, those grated drains you often see across driveways or patios, are great for capturing surface water runoff and preventing it from pooling near the house. Properly installed, these systems are incredibly effective.

Designing Effective Drainage Systems for Crawlspaces, Basements, and Foundations

Designing the *right* system starts with a thorough site assessment. You have to look at how the land slopes around the house – does water flow towards it or away? What type of soil are we dealing with? Does it drain well (good percolation) or stay saturated? Where are the downspouts discharging? Are there low spots in the yard where water collects? Understanding these existing conditions is critical before recommending any specific drainage solution. One size definitely does not fit all.

Once the assessment is done, we plan the system. For groundwater issues around a foundation, exterior French drains or interior drain tile systems leading to a sump pump might be best. If surface water pooling in the yard is the main problem, grading corrections, channel drains, or strategically placed catch basins could be the answer. Crawlspaces often benefit from perimeter drains combined with a vapor barrier. The goal is to choose the most effective components for the specific problems identified.

Sump pumps are the heart of many drainage systems, so integrating them properly is crucial. This means selecting the right size pump for the expected water volume, ensuring the discharge line carries water far enough away from the house (and doesn’t freeze in winter!), and strongly considering a battery backup system. Power outages often happen during heavy storms – precisely when you need your sump pump most! A backup ensures continuous protection even when the grid goes down.

Sometimes, solving water problems involves reshaping the landscape. Correcting the grade so the ground slopes away from the foundation (a minimum drop of 6 inches over the first 10 feet is a common recommendation) is fundamental. Strategic placement of landscaping features like swales (shallow vegetated channels) can also help guide surface water away naturally. It’s thinking about how water moves across the *entire* property, not just at the foundation edge.

Different drainage components have different lifespans and maintenance needs. PVC pipes used in modern drains last for decades, but the fabric filter around French drains can sometimes clog over time, especially in silty soils. Sump pumps typically last 7-10 years. Channel drain grates need occasional cleaning. Understanding these factors helps you budget for future upkeep and compare the long-term value of different system types. Sometimes a slightly higher initial investment means less maintenance later.

Maintenance and Monitoring for Durable Waterproofing and Drainage Performance

Okay, so you’ve got a great system installed. Job done? Not quite! Like any home system, drainage and waterproofing require some ongoing attention to keep performing optimally. I recommend property owners set a regular inspection schedule. At least twice a year (spring and fall are ideal), take a look. Test your sump pump by pouring water into the pit to make sure it kicks on and off correctly. Check that the discharge line outlet outside isn’t blocked by debris, ice, or landscaping.

Here’s a quick seasonal checklist for our Boise-area conditions:

  • Spring: After snowmelt/heavy rains, check basement/crawlspace for dampness. Clear leaves/debris from window wells, gutters, downspout extensions, and any visible drain grates. Test the sump pump.
  • Summer: Ensure landscaping isn’t overgrown around discharge lines or blocking drainage paths. Check that grading still slopes away from the foundation (soil can settle).
  • Fall: Clear fallen leaves from gutters, downspouts, and drains *before* the wet season hits hard. Ensure the sump pump discharge line is clear and protected from freezing. Inspect visible foundation walls for new cracks.
  • Winter: Keep the sump pump discharge area clear of snow and ice to prevent blockage and potential backup. Monitor basement/crawlspace during thaw cycles.

Is preventive maintenance worth the effort and minor cost? Absolutely. Compare the cost of spending an hour or two inspecting and cleaning drains, or having a professional service your sump pump periodically, versus the expense of cleaning up a flooded basement, replacing ruined belongings, dealing with mold remediation, and potentially repairing structural damage. The math heavily favors proactive care; it almost always saves money (and stress!) in the long run.

Finally, know the warning signs that your existing system might need an upgrade or expansion. Is the sump pump running constantly, even in dry weather? Are you noticing new damp spots or water stains? Has the ground settled, changing the drainage pattern? Have you finished a basement or added an extension, altering the load on the original system? These might indicate it’s time to reassess and potentially enhance your home’s water defenses before a small issue becomes a major failure.
